This week, I'm going to make some food for the freezer, so I have things I can defrost and reheat. When I make soups, stews, sauces, and chilies, I try to double the recipe and freeze half in family-sized portions. If I do one or two dishes this way every weekend, I wind up with a wide variety of meals that I can just defrost and heat up. These meals are a great gap-filler for those nights we just don't want to eat whatever was planned. For example, last week, I baked a ham for Sunday. Although I had creative ways to use the ham, by Wednesday, we were all ready to swear off ham forever. So I needed a gap-filler. In that case, it was hot dogs. But if I'd had chili or spaghetti sauce in the freezer, we would have eaten much better that night.

So this week, I'm making a big pot of red sauce. I can freeze most of it and use it later for spaghetti, rigatoni, lasagna, chicken Parmesan, and even pizza. I'm also going to make a big pot of chili. Finally, I'm going to roast a chicken, and we'll get two meals out of that. So here's the plan:

I'm going to do much of the prepping on Saturday and Sunday. I'll make the spaghetti sauce and chili on Saturday. I'll make the Tikka Masala from a Now We're Cooking recipe. I'll put the chicken in the marinade on Saturday and freeze it, then move it to the refrigerator for defrosting on Tuesday night. Then Wednesday, all I'll have to do is quickly cook the chicken in the sauce.
